Overview

An AI Implementation Consultant is a professional who guides organizations in integrating Artificial Intelligence (AI) solutions into their operations. This role combines technical expertise with business acumen to drive innovation and efficiency through AI adoption. Key Responsibilities:

  1. Needs Assessment: Identify opportunities for AI integration and conduct gap analyses.
  2. Solution Design: Collaborate with stakeholders to design AI solutions aligned with business objectives.
  3. Technology Selection: Evaluate and recommend appropriate AI technologies and tools.
  4. Implementation: Oversee AI solution deployment, including data preparation and model training.
  5. Data Management: Ensure data quality, security, and compliance.
  6. Training and Support: Provide guidance on AI tool usage and offer ongoing support.
  7. Performance Monitoring: Establish metrics and systems to evaluate AI model performance.
  8. Ethics and Compliance: Ensure AI solutions adhere to ethical standards and regulations. Skills and Qualifications:
  • Technical Skills: Proficiency in AI technologies, programming languages, and frameworks
  • Business Acumen: Understanding of business operations and ability to communicate complex concepts
  • Project Management: Experience with Agile methodologies and project management tools
  • Data Analysis: Strong analytical skills and familiarity with data visualization tools
  • Communication: Excellent interpersonal and collaborative skills Education and Certifications:
  • Typically a bachelor's degree in Computer Science, Data Science, or related field
  • Advanced degrees (master's or Ph.D.) can be advantageous
  • Relevant certifications in AI, machine learning, or data science Career Path:
  • Entry-Level: Data Analyst or Junior Data Scientist roles
  • Mid-Level: AI Engineer or Senior Data Scientist positions
  • Senior Roles: Lead AI Consultant or Director of AI Strategy Industry Applications: AI Implementation Consultants work across various sectors, including healthcare, finance, retail, and manufacturing, applying AI to solve industry-specific challenges and drive innovation. This role is crucial in helping organizations leverage AI to achieve strategic goals, improve efficiency, and maintain a competitive edge in an increasingly AI-driven business landscape.

Requirements

To excel as an AI Implementation Consultant, professionals should possess a combination of technical expertise, business acumen, and soft skills. Key requirements include: Educational Background:

  • Bachelor's degree in Computer Science, Information Technology, Mathematics, Statistics, or Engineering
  • Advanced degrees (Master's or Ph.D.) beneficial for complex projects Technical Skills:
  • Programming proficiency: Python, R, Java, C++
  • AI and ML frameworks: TensorFlow, PyTorch, Keras, Scikit-learn
  • Data science tools: Pandas, NumPy, Matplotlib, Seaborn
  • Cloud platforms: AWS, Azure, Google Cloud Platform
  • Data management: SQL, NoSQL, data warehousing, ETL processes
  • Big data technologies: Hadoop, Spark Business and Consulting Skills:
  • Strong business acumen
  • Excellent communication skills
  • Project management expertise
  • Stakeholder management proficiency Analytical and Problem-Solving Skills:
  • Advanced data analysis capabilities
  • Strong problem-solving aptitude
  • Critical thinking skills Industry Knowledge:
  • Domain expertise in relevant sectors
  • Understanding of regulatory compliance (e.g., GDPR, HIPAA) Soft Skills:
  • Collaborative mindset
  • Adaptability and flexibility
  • Commitment to continuous learning Certifications:
  • AI/Data Science certifications
  • Cloud platform certifications (e.g., AWS, Google Cloud) Experience:
  • Proven track record in AI implementation
  • Portfolio of successful projects and case studies By possessing these skills and qualifications, AI Implementation Consultants can effectively guide organizations through the complexities of AI adoption, ensuring successful integration and maximizing the value of AI solutions.

Salary Ranges (US Market, 2024)

Salary ranges for AI Implementation Consultants in the US market can vary based on factors such as location, industry, experience, and specific skills. Here's an overview of estimated compensation levels:

Entry-Level (0-3 years experience)

  • Base Salary: $80,000 - $110,000/year
  • Total Compensation: $88,000 - $132,000/year (including bonuses/stock options)

Mid-Level (4-7 years experience)

  • Base Salary: $110,000 - $140,000/year
  • Total Compensation: $126,500 - $175,000/year

Senior-Level (8-12 years experience)

  • Base Salary: $140,000 - $170,000/year
  • Total Compensation: $168,000 - $221,000/year

Lead/Manager-Level (13+ years experience)

  • Base Salary: $170,000 - $200,000/year
  • Total Compensation: $212,500 - $270,000/year

Factors Influencing Compensation

  1. Location: Salaries tend to be higher in major tech hubs like San Francisco, New York City, and Seattle.
  2. Industry: Finance, healthcare, and technology sectors often offer higher compensation due to the critical nature of AI implementations.
  3. Specialized Skills: Expertise in machine learning, NLP, computer vision, or specific AI tools can command premium salaries.
  4. Education and Certifications: Advanced degrees or industry-recognized certifications can positively impact compensation.
  5. Company Size and Type: Large enterprises or specialized AI consulting firms may offer more competitive packages.
  6. Project Complexity: Experience with large-scale or innovative AI implementations can lead to higher compensation. Remember that these figures are estimates and can vary based on specific companies, individual qualifications, and current market conditions. Best Practices

To ensure successful, efficient, and ethical AI implementation, consultants should follow these best practices:

  1. Define Clear Objectives and Scope
  • Articulate specific business goals for the AI solution
  • Define project scope and ensure alignment with business objectives
  1. Conduct Thorough Needs Assessment
  • Analyze current processes to identify AI value-add areas
  • Gather stakeholder requirements
  • Assess data availability and quality
  1. Ensure Data Quality and Preparation
  • Verify data accuracy, completeness, and relevance
  • Handle data preprocessing and feature engineering
  • Implement data governance policies
  1. Select Appropriate AI Technology
  • Evaluate AI technologies based on project needs
  • Consider scalability, performance, and integration factors
  1. Develop and Train Models Effectively
  • Follow best practices in model development (e.g., cross-validation, hyperparameter tuning)
  • Prevent overfitting and ensure generalization
  • Document the development process
  1. Address Ethical Considerations
  • Ensure fairness, transparency, and unbiased AI systems
  • Implement measures to prevent data bias
  • Comply with relevant data protection regulations
  1. Conduct Rigorous Testing and Validation
  • Perform thorough model testing and validation
  • Conduct comparative analyses (e.g., A/B testing)
  • Validate alignment with business objectives
  1. Plan Careful Deployment and Integration
  • Consider scalability, security, and system integration
  • Utilize DevOps practices for smooth deployment
  • Ensure compliance with organizational security policies
  1. Implement Monitoring and Maintenance Strategies
  • Set up performance monitoring systems
  • Establish processes for continuous improvement
  • Address post-deployment issues promptly
  1. Engage Stakeholders and Provide Training
  • Maintain consistent stakeholder communication
  • Train end-users on effective AI system use
  • Foster organizational AI literacy
  1. Maintain Documentation and Transparency
  • Document AI system details comprehensively
  • Ensure transparency in system operations
  • Utilize explainable AI techniques
  1. Manage Risks Effectively
  • Identify potential AI implementation risks
  • Develop and update risk mitigation strategies By adhering to these best practices, AI implementation consultants can ensure successful, sustainable, and value-driven AI projects that align with organizational goals and ethical standards.

Lead Statistical Programming Manager

Lead Statistical Programming Manager

The role of a Lead Statistical Programming Manager is crucial in the pharmaceutical and biotechnology industries, focusing on managing statistical programming activities for clinical trials and regulatory submissions. This position requires a blend of technical expertise, leadership skills, and regulatory knowledge. Key Responsibilities: - Project Leadership: Oversee statistical programming activities for clinical studies, ensuring compliance with project standards and strategies from study start-up through regulatory approval and product launch. - Technical Guidance: Provide expert support for developing and quality-controlling tables, listings, graphs, and other analytical systems, adhering to industry standards like CDISC SDTM and ADaM. - Regulatory Submissions: Prepare programming deliverables for regulatory filings, including Biologics License Applications (BLA), working closely with health authorities and stakeholders. - Team Management: Lead and mentor a team of statistical programmers, managing resources and performance. - Quality and Compliance: Ensure deliverables meet regulatory requirements and adhere to corporate and departmental Standard Operating Procedures (SOPs). Skills and Qualifications: - Advanced SAS Programming: Proficiency in SAS, particularly in clinical data environments. - CDISC Standards: In-depth knowledge of Clinical Data Interchange Standards Consortium (CDISC) data structures and standards. - Database Management: Understanding of relational databases and complex data systems. - Communication: Strong ability to collaborate with cross-functional teams and stakeholders. - Education: Typically requires a Master's or Bachelor's degree in Statistics, Computer Science, Mathematics, or related fields. - Experience: Generally, 7-10 years of relevant experience in pharmaceutical clinical development. Daily Activities: - Coordinate project preparation, execution, reporting, and documentation. - Provide technical guidance on complex programming tasks and processes. - Maintain consistent code, logs, and output documentation in a regulated environment. - Develop clear programming specifications. Work Environment: - Can be remote, on-site, or hybrid, depending on company policies. - Requires independent work, sound judgment, and adaptability within existing policies and standards. The Lead Statistical Programming Manager plays a vital role in ensuring timely, high-quality delivery of statistical programming activities while contributing to departmental process and methodology development.
